GOVERNANCE Activist Rueben Lifuka says he is concerned with the number of people who are being paid at Cabinet Office for doing nothing because of failure to decide their fate. Speaking on Hot FM’s Hot Breakfast Show, Friday, Lifuka said there was a lot of wastage of public resources in the country. “As a country, there is so much wastage of public resources and I think that one of the things that we need to do and learn from the Auditor General’s Report is how can we deal with the wastage of public resources.
